Telemetry Compression — Driftlane Ingest API

Clients should compress telemetry payloads with zstd level 3 before posting to the Driftlane ingest endpoint; gzip is accepted but deprecated and adds roughly 30% overhead at peak. Set the content-encoding header accordingly, as uncompressed bodies over 1 MB are rejected. For release validation, authenticate against the internal ingest gateway using the key below.

service key, bajog-yahop: kto7_mMHVCpJ

**Mgmt Meeting Minutes — Retiring the Brightline Range**

Quick recap for sales leads at Fenholt Supplies: we agreed to retire the Brightline fixture range by year-end. Remaining stock moves to clearance pricing next month, and accounts on standing orders get migrated to the Lumetta range. Trade-in incentives were approved in principle. The confidential note on next steps sits just below.

board note of bajof-bajeg: The pricing group signed off on a budget of $13.4 million for Project Sildor. The renewal with Lamixek Holdings closes at $48.9 million a year, 49 percent above the last contract.

## FoldaPort Environments — Locker Access Flow

FoldaPort's laundry-locker access flow runs in three environments: dev, staging, and prod. Each environment issues locker unlock tokens through a separate signer, so a token minted in staging will never open a prod locker door. The staging signer rotates nightly; prod rotates weekly during the Tuesday maintenance window. Before the weekly sync, please verify your local setup matches the current staging values. The active configuration for staging is as follows.

deployment values, fahap-hahaf:
[casdor]
port = 9200
region = south-2
host = casdor.qirvanworks.corp
timeout_ms = 3000
retries = 4

## FAQ: How do blue-green deploys work for the billing worker?

Q: How do I cut over Ledgerbee's billing worker?

A: Deploy to the idle color, run the smoke suite, then flip traffic in Switchyard. Never flip mid-invoice-run — check the batch dashboard first. Rollback is the same flip reversed. If Switchyard rejects your flip with a lockout error, the deploy lock needs manual release. Release it from the emergency console, which requires the recovery passphrase below.

strongbox words: briiel-zoreth-noveth-pelys-druwyn-feniel-lamvan-ulaius-kasion